``` 内容主体大纲 1. 引言 - 介绍以太坊和钱包节点的概念 - 为什么节点大小对用户和开发者重要 2. 以太坊钱包节点的基本概述 - 什么是以太坊钱包节点 - 各种类型的节点(全节点、轻节点等) 3. 以太坊节点大小的影响因素 - 链上数据的增长 - 交易频率 - 用户活动和智能合约执行 4. 如何查看和管理以太坊节点的大小 - 使用区块浏览器 - 本地节点的设置和维护 5. 节点大小的技术挑战 - 存储需求 - 备份与恢复的复杂性 6. 针对节点大小的策略 - 数据压缩技术 - 轻节点的优势 7. 未来展望 - 以太坊2.0及其对节点大小的影响 - 区块链技术的演变 8. 结论 - 总结节点大小的重要性和影响 内容开始 ### 引言

以太坊,是一种开源的区块链平台,支持智能合约的创建与执行。作为加密货币领域的重要组成部分,以太坊的生态系统不断扩展,吸引了数百万用户和开发者。在以太坊的网络中,钱包节点是不可或缺的元素,它们负责存储和验证网络中的交易与合约。随着以太坊网络的发展,一个常见问题是以太坊钱包节点的大小是多少,以及这一大小会受到何种因素的影响。

了解以太坊钱包节点的大小不仅对普通用户重要,对于开发者、矿工乃至企业来说,都是一个非常关键的概念。节点的大小直接关系到运行节点的系统要求、存储成本以及网络的效率。因此,清晰地理解这些因素,有助于用户做出更明智的决策。

### 以太坊钱包节点的基本概述

什么是以太坊钱包节点

以太坊钱包节点是直接与以太坊区块链网络相连的设备或软件,其主要任务是存储和维护区块链的副本。节点不仅可以发送和接收以太币(ETH),同时还能够执行智能合约并验证交易。根据节点运行的方式不同,它们可以分为全节点、轻节点和中继节点等。

各种类型的节点

思考一个接近且的标题


以太坊钱包节点的大小及其影响因素分析

以太坊网络中的节点通常可以分为以下几种:

  • 全节点:存储整个区块链数据,负责区块验证和交易确认,提供高安全性和去中心化。
  • 轻节点:仅存储必要的信息,以便快速与全节点交互,适合存储空间有限的设备。
  • 中继节点:在不同网络间传递信息,通常用在更复杂的网络环境中。
### 以太坊节点大小的影响因素

链上数据的增长

以太坊节点的大小直接与链上数据的增长有关。随着时间的推移,新的区块和智能合约被创建,这导致链上数据迅速累积。例如,随着新的交易发生和应用的发展,节点需要存储更多的历史数据,这直接影响了节点的大小。

交易频率

思考一个接近且的标题


以太坊钱包节点的大小及其影响因素分析

交易频率同样是影响节点大小的重要因素。高交易频率意味着更多的交易数据需要被记录,这对于全节点尤其显著,因为它们必须存储所有的交易记录。反之,较低的交易频率意味着节点的增长会更为缓慢。

用户活动和智能合约执行

以太坊支持的智能合约执行也会影响节点的大小。当用户与智能合约进行交互时,会生成额外的数据记录,这些数据最终也会被全节点保存。特别是一些复杂的智能合约,可能会产生大量的状态变化及交易数据,从而进一步增加节点的存储需求。

### 如何查看和管理以太坊节点的大小

使用区块浏览器

用户可以通过区块浏览器查看以太坊网络中的各类信息,包括节点数量、交易量和区块链高度等数据。这些工具常常提供直观的界面,方便用户了解现有节点的状态及其数据的增长趋势。

本地节点的设置和维护

对于希望运行全节点的用户而言,了解如何有效管理本地节点的大小也是相当重要的。用户需定期检查节点的存储使用情况,及时清理不必要的数据,确保节点运行流畅。最佳的做法是设置合理的备份策略,以防数据丢失。

### 节点大小的技术挑战

存储需求

随着区块链数据的不断增长,存储需求成为技术上的一个主要挑战。对于运行全节点的用户而言,必须配置足够的存储空间来存储完整的区块链数据。这将涉及硬件与成本的考量,如何在资源有限的情况下节点的存储显得尤为重要。

备份与恢复的复杂性

节点的备份和恢复过程不仅需要时间和空间,还可能会遇到各种技术问题。如果不定期进行备份,用户可能会面临严重的数据损失风险。因此,制定一个切实可行的备份和恢复流程对于保证节点的健康运行至关重要。

### 针对节点大小的策略

数据压缩技术

在以太坊区块链的实际运行中,应用数据压缩技术能够有效降低节点的存储需求。通过对历史数据进行压缩和整理,用户能够在不影响节点性能的情况下,节省宝贵的硬盘空间。

轻节点的优势

轻节点是另一种应对节点大小挑战的策略。这种节点只需存储必要的信息,通过与全节点的交互获取更多数据,不仅节省了空间,还提高了交易的速度和效率。轻节点适合于存储空间有限的设备,如移动终端。

### 未来展望

以太坊2.0及其对节点大小的影响

以太坊2.0的推出将带来分片技术,这意味着区块链可以更高效地处理交易和智能合约。通过将数据划分到不同的分片中,节点的数据存储需求将会明显减轻,进而提高网络的性能和安全性。

区块链技术的演变

随着技术的不断进步,区块链将向更高的效率和更低的存储需求迈进。新型的共识机制、数据结构及算法,可能会显著改变节点的存储模式,从而使得区块链网络更加友好和灵活。

### 结论

以太坊钱包节点的大小是一个相对复杂的课题,涉及到多方面的因素,从链上数据的增长到用户行为的影响都对节点大小产生着重要作用。理解这一点不仅有助于用户有效地管理他们的钱包节点,还能为开发者提供技术上的指导。随着区块链技术的不断进步,节点管理和也将使得加密货币生态更加成熟,用户体验也会被进一步提升。

### 六个相关问题 1. 什么是以太坊全节点和轻节点的区别? 2. 以太坊节点的存储需求如何满足? 3. 如何以太坊节点的性能? 4. 运行以太坊节点的成本是多少? 5. 在什么情况下需要备份以太坊节点? 6. 以太坊2.0如何影响节点的大小? #### 1. 什么是以太坊全节点和轻节点的区别?

全节点与轻节点的定义

全节点(Full Node)存储整个区块链的历史记录,包括所有交易和智能合约。它负责验证新的区块,确保网络的安全性和有效性,因而需要大量的存储空间和计算资源。轻节点(Light Node),则只下载链上的必要信息,通常是区块头而不是完整的区块。轻节点通过与全节点的互动来获取完整的信息,由于只需存储有限的数据,它们的存储需求大大降低。

全节点的优缺点

全节点的优势在于其高安全性和去中心化特性。由于它们直接与区块链交互,能够确保数据的真实与完整性。然而,它们也存在设备要求高、存储空间需求大等劣势,普通用户需承担较高的运行成本。

轻节点的优缺点

轻节点的优势在于其低存储需求和简易的操作,适合普通用户使用。用户能够在不占用大量存储空间的情况下参与到以太坊网络中。然而,轻节点依赖于全节点提供的数据,可能面临一定的安全性风险,自身的去中心化程度较低。

#### 2. 以太坊节点的存储需求如何满足?

区块链的存储结构

以太坊节点存储的是一个不断增长的数据结构。如果要满足这个存储需求,用户需要确保他们的硬件设施有足够的空间来容纳完整的区块链。通常情况下,用户需要SSD硬盘,以提高读写速度,降低延迟。特别是现在的以太坊网络,区块链数据已达到上百千兆字节。

云存储的选择

对于不想在本地存储数据的用户,云存储是一个理想多选方案。用户可以在云平台上架设全节点,使用云服务提供商的资源,避免了本地存储的繁琐。此外,云存储不仅可以有效节省成本,且在数据备份和安全性方面有一定的保障。

节点管理的最佳实践

定期清理节点的冗余数据、定期备份等都是必须遵循的最佳实践。这些措施的实施不仅有利于节省存储资源,也能够提升节点的运行效率。此外,用户应随时关注以太坊的社区动态,以便了解新兴的技术和工具,节点的存储负担。

#### 3. 如何以太坊节点的性能?

使用SSD存储

为了提高以太坊节点的性能,使用固态硬盘(SSD)是一个有效的措施。SSD提供了更快的数据读取和写入速度,这对大量读写的区块链数据尤为重要。SSD能够显著减少节点启动及同步的时间,用户能够更快地参与到网络中。

配置更高带宽的网络连接

节点与网络的交互频繁,带宽不足将直接影响节点的性能。通过改进网络连接,确保节点具有足够的上传和下载速度,可以改善交易确认的时间和区块的传播速度,从而增强节点的整体表现。

定期维护与更新

定期对节点进行维护与更新也是节点性能的重要部分。保持节点软件的最新版本,能够有效地提升安全性和响应速度,防止出现漏洞和性能下降。一般建议至少每月检查一次节点的状态,必要时进行更新和配置。

#### 4. 运行以太坊节点的成本是多少?

硬件成本

运行以太坊节点的成本与设备的配置关系密切。全节点通常需要高性能的CPU、较大的内存和SSD存储,因此硬件成本可能会相对较高。根据不同的配置,整体硬件成本在几百到几千美元不等。如果选择云服务,则需要考虑月租费用,根据提供的存储与计算能力不同,费用也会有所不同。

电费和网络成本

除了硬件,节点的运行还需要考虑电费和网络费用。对于持续运行的全节点,这两个开支可能占到运营成本的相当一部分。为此,用户在选择运行地点时需考虑尤其电费廉价的区域,会直接影响每月的运行成本。

时间成本

虽然时间成本不易量化,但无疑是影响以太坊节点运营的一部分。全节点需要定期检查更新、维护与数据备份,这将占用用户的时间精力。如果没有专业的技术支持,用户可能在日常维护上耗费大量时间,这同样构成了隐性成本。

#### 5. 在什么情况下需要备份以太坊节点?

定期备份的重要性

对于任何形式的数据存储,定期备份都是一项重要的安全措施。以太坊节点也不例外,用户应定期备份节点数据,以防范设备故障、数据丢失或意外删除等风险。一般建议每隔一到两周进行一次全面备份,以维护节点的安全状态。

在进行节点更新时

每当用户打算对节点进行更新或升级时,备份是一个必要的步骤。更新过程中可能会出现错误,导致数据丢失和节点崩溃。而备份既能保证数据的完整性,又提供了一种恢复点,确保用户能够在发生问题时快速恢复节点功能。

系统故障或数据损坏后

如果节点发生系统故障或数据损坏,备份则是唯一的恢复方式。及时的备份能够帮助用户最大程度地减少数据损失,快速恢复节点工作。而若没有备份,用户可能因丢失重要数据而面临巨大的损失,因此备份应被视为一种常态化的管理行为。

#### 6. 以太坊2.0如何影响节点的大小?

分片技术的应用

以太坊2.0将在其架构中引入分片技术,这将意味着不再需要每个节点都存储完整的区块链数据。随着分片的实施,链上数据将被划分到不同的分片中,这样每个节点只需关心一部分数据,从而显著降低了单个节点的存储需求。对于普通用户而言,运行全节点的难度和门槛将有所降低。

共识机制的转变

以太坊2.0也将从工作量证明(PoW)转向权益证明(PoS),这一转变了节点参与的机制。在PoS机制下,节点只需证明其持有的以太币余额,而不是通过运算力来验证区块。这将降低节点的资源消耗,提升网络的可扩展性和可用性。

未来的生态系统

随着以太坊2.0的推进,整个生态系统将变得更加高效与灵活。用户能够在不必承担过高的存储和计算压力的情况下参与网络,促进普通用户的参与和分散化趋势的发展。未来以太坊将展现出更强大的数据处理能力和用户友好的特性,这将进一步推动区块链技术的普及。

以上是围绕以太坊钱包节点大小的分析及相关问题的详细探讨。希望能为有意深入了解以太坊及其运作机制的用户提供有价值的信息。